Why Burned-Out Motors Reach the Front Desk Before Maintenance Does
Continuous duty rating is the only horsepower figure that matters past month three.
I have pulled apart stair climber motors in hotel basements that failed after ninety days because the original spec sheet only listed peak output. A commercial stair climber electric stepper machine running eighteen hours a day needs a motor rated for sustained thermal load, not a burst number that looks good on a brochure. Frequently Asked Questions
Q: What is the difference between continuous and peak horsepower?
A: Peak horsepower describes the maximum output a motor can deliver for a few seconds, while continuous horsepower is the sustained output it can maintain without overheating. A stair climber running twelve or more hours daily must be rated by continuous output. Always request the duty-cycle specification sheet before comparing models.

Q: How is heart rate captured and how accurate is it?
A: Heart rate is measured through handlebar contact sensors, which provide reliable readings during steady-state stepping. For high-intensity intervals where grip position changes frequently, pairing a chest strap improves accuracy. We recommend testing both methods during commissioning to match your programming style.
Q: What daily maintenance does the electric drive require?
A: Wipe down the step surfaces and handlebar sensors after each business day to prevent sweat buildup. Check the step belt for lateral drift weekly and adjust tension per the guide. Inspect the motor air intake monthly and clear dust to maintain thermal performance during continuous operation.
